Responsibilities

Job Summary

Prepares baked goods according to recipes and production specifications.

  • Bake breads, pies, cakes, cookies and other pastries as necessary per the provided production and catering sheets and assist in production planning to meet daily requirements.
  • Ensure proper food preparation by utilizing approved recipes, following prescribed production standards and use of proper equipment.
  • Assist with the completion of production records to include waste tracking, used/unused portions and product shortages and inform supervisor when supplies are low.
  • Ensure proper presentation, food quality, portion control and maintenance of proper serving temperatures.
  • Maintain sanitation and orderliness of all equipment, supplies and utensils within work area.
  • Handle food items appropriately and with all safety regulations in mind during preparation and service.
  • Clean equipment and workstation thoroughly before leaving the area for other assignments and keep display equipment clean and free of debris.
  • Consistently exhibit the ability to keep up with peak production and service calmly, accurately and efficiently.
  • Check to ensure that all food is presented, served and displayed per standards.
  • Follow principles of sanitation and safety in handling food and equipment, ensuring corporate and OSHA safety standards are followed.
